From 03ca413fa0646a98eefcf5709422da9902296501 Mon Sep 17 00:00:00 2001 From: Hector Sanjuan Date: Mon, 20 Aug 2018 20:30:43 +0200 Subject: [PATCH] Make all calls local when no host is set. Right now this panics badly. Useful for testing too. --- client.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/client.go b/client.go index d9c5a3d..b9072bf 100644 --- a/client.go +++ b/client.go @@ -234,7 +234,7 @@ func (c *Client) makeCall(call *Call) { ) // Handle local RPC calls - if call.Dest == "" || call.Dest == c.host.ID() { + if call.Dest == "" || c.host == nil || call.Dest == c.host.ID() { logger.Debugf( "local call: %s.%s", call.SvcID.Name,